Artist Name: koi

Tell us something about you that fans should know:

As an artist, I would describe myself as a motivated individual that finds gratitude from overcoming an obstacle, whether it be in making music or in life, and learning from that to become better.

Where are you from and what’s the music scene like there?

I'm was raised on gospel/orchestral music in a small town named Brighton, Michigan and moved to Phoenix, Arizona at the age of 11. From there, I was introduced to pop music, rap, hip hop, and the most influential, EDM. In the summer of 2016 I went back to my roots in Michigan to check out the Electric Forest music festival 5 hours away in Rothbury where I decided that was what I wanted to do this as a passion.

How have your life experiences influenced your music?

In the first 18 years of my life I seemed to lack purpose in what I was doing. I played sports from the ages of 8-18 and even then it still seemed empty to me. Once I went to Electric Forest it seemed like everything made sense to me. I knew what I wanted to do, regardless of how difficult it may have been to overcome it. During those previous 18 years it seemed like I was a square peg trying to fit into a round hole; things just didn't work out. I was sad, confused, and exhausted. Now, when I make music, I want something that encompasses an emotion. Firstly, I want it ot be happy and joyous, to match the mood I have when I make it. Or, I want someone to get a nasty bass face and head bang, as I imagine I would do when I drop the song at a festival. The beauty of music is feelings being expressed through sound.

Who would you most like to collaborate with?

Illenium/Kaivon
